1, 引言Python开源网络爬虫项目启动之初,我们就把网络爬虫分成两类:即时爬虫和收割式网络爬虫。为了使用各种应用场景,该项目的整个网络爬虫产品线包含了四类产品,如下图所示:本实战是上图中的“独立python爬虫”的一个实例,以采集安居客房产经纪人(http://shenzhen.anjuke.com/tycoon/nanshan/p1/信息为例,记录整个采集流程,包括python和依赖库的安装
硬件部分 该方案的主要硬件构成如下: 其中TLC2543通过4线制SPI接口与英利工控主板连接,具体信号定义如下: &n
系列文章目录第一章:汽车发动机数据采集上位机环境的搭建 第二章:Labview中的DAQ助手中器件详解 第三章:利用labview和NI数据采集卡采集汽车发动机中温度传感器的电压信号并处理 文章目录系列文章目录前言一、第一个程序1.如何开始第一个程序的2.程序的出错与调试二、第二个程序1.如何开始第二个程序的2.第二个程序的调试与出错总结 前言终于来到了实战阶段,前期打基础,后期身体扑!这个程序是
转载
2023-10-20 20:34:41
345阅读
系列文章目录第一章:汽车发动机数据采集上位机环境的搭建 第二章:Labview中的DAQ助手中器件详解 文章目录系列文章目录前言一、DAQ采集函数中的器件1.DAQ助手2.DAQ创建虚拟通道函数3.开始触发函数4.定时函数5.启动任务函数6.停止任务函数7.读取函数8.写入函数9.结束前等待函数10.属性节点总结 前言发动机传感器的信息采集对于后续在发动机上的实验有着积极促进作用。所以老板一直催着
转载
2024-08-28 19:38:29
217阅读
NI PCI-6229 多功能数据采集卡NI PCI-6229 多功能数据采集卡 详情介绍:NI PCI-6229是National Instruments(NI)公司生产的一款多功能数据采集卡,专为高速数据采集和控制应用而设计。以下是关于NI PCI-6229的详细介绍:主要功能: 模拟输入:具有16个模拟输入通道,16位分辨率,以及高达250 kS/s的
# 如何实现“NI采集卡支持python”
## 整体流程
以下是实现“NI采集卡支持python”的整体流程: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 安装NI-DAQmx驱动 |
| 2 | 安装PyDAQmx库 |
| 3 | 编写python程序 |
## 操作步骤
### 步骤一:安装NI-DAQmx驱动
首先,你需要从NI官网上下载并安装NI-D
原创
2024-02-23 06:14:47
1033阅读
本章需要熟悉: 1、try…except函数的用法 2、urllib库 3、BeautifulSoup库1、浏览网页的过程:类似于收发邮件。想要浏览的网站有一个所在服务器,当你想浏览网页内容时,从你的电脑会发送一个数据包,包括: 1、发件人(你的IP地址) 2、内容(浏览请求) 3、收件人(服务器地址) 不知道这种数据包有没有加密,如果能够被破解,那真是细思极恐… 浏览器的作用就是创建数据包,进行
转载
2024-07-25 16:31:18
74阅读
文章目录?1、目标网址?2、接口分析?3、代码实现 【JS 逆向百例】 1/100 学习记录:哈喽~ 前面我们接触了一些JS逆向的数据获取,如果前面的百度,有道翻译和正方教务系统的登录加密你已掌握,说明我们已经入门啦。征程万里风正劲,重任千钧再出发。后面还有很长的路要走,让我们一起努力吧!今天的学习记录是关于烯牛数据网站的数据采集,这是一个很综合的例子, 它的返回数据和请求体都进行了加密。 这篇
本文从本人的163博客搬迁至此。为了展示连续信号采集的方法,以其外部触发采集功能。我用运算放大器实现了一个最简单的低频压控振荡器(VCO),作为USB-6009采集的信号源。在LabVIEW下编写的应用软件的控制下,USB-6009同时采集VCO产生的两路模拟信号。在波形图控件中可以比较、观测两路信号的幅度和相位关系。另外,本例还将涉及USB-6009的外部触发采集功能的编程方法。一、压控振荡器电
PCI-6289数据采集板卡市场由于基于PC的控制器被证明可以像PLC一样可*,并且被操作和维护人员接受,所以,一个接一个的制造商至少在部分生产中正在采用PC控制方案。基于PC的控制系统易于安装和使用,有的诊断功能,为系统集成商提供了更灵活的选择,从长远角度看,PC控制系统维护成本低。由于可编程控制器(PLC)受PC控制的威胁大,所以PLC供应商对PC的应用感到很不安。事实上,可编程控制器(PLC
安装NiDAQ 20.0, 这是for win7 最后一个版本了. 有同事安装的版本不对,就会出现如下的错误 插上USB口的NI采集设备, 在NiMax程序里就能看见 如果没有Ni设备,可以安装仿真设备, 在[设备与接口]处点右键,[新建...] 没有插Ni仪器出来的异常 Additional in ...
转载
2021-09-13 17:30:00
888阅读
2评论
参赛话题:学习笔记博客写作背景----项目中解决的问题最近遇到一个使用stm32单片机多路采集信号的项目,还需要在上位机进行波形的查看,信号算法的处理,初步定为使用labview编写上位机程序进行处理。为啥用labview呢,因为LabVIEW是NI的数据采集创新软件产品,其全称是实验室虚拟仪器工程平台(Laboratory Virtual Instrument Engineering Workb
# NI LabVIEW与Python的结合:高效的数据处理与分析
在现代工程与科学研究中,数据处理与分析是不可或缺的环节,而NI LabVIEW和Python这两种工具分别在实验室和数据分析领域中占据重要地位。结合这两者的优势,能够大大提高数据处理的效率和灵活性。
## 什么是NI LabVIEW?
NI LabVIEW(Laboratory Virtual Instrument Engi
原创
2024-10-03 05:47:25
47阅读
发生背景。当我测出来的信号数据进行傅里叶分析的时候,发现设置的信号频率和自己实际得到的频率并不相等。自己设置的20020的采样率其实实际采样率为25600,导致我进行傅里叶分析的时候时域是不对的。在测试76hz的信号时候分析得到60hz。1.首先了解一个基本概念,采集卡的采样率取决于主时基频率。例如我现在使用的采样卡NI9234的主时基,为13.1072Mhz,所以我们的可用采样率:
转载
2024-03-06 10:33:55
16阅读
说的 捱三顶四 地方
转载
2010-03-17 16:09:50
335阅读
1、读写文件:
import os
os.path.join():单个文件和路径上的文件名的字符串作为参数,返回一个文件路径的字符串,包含正确的路径分隔符(其中双斜杠,因为每一个到斜杠需要转义)
os.getcwd():获取当前工作路径的字符串
os.chdir():改变当前工作路径函数
相对路径 和 绝对路径
相对路径:它相对于程
python的概述和简介概述:python是一种解释型、交互式、言面向对象的编程语言;优点:语法简单易学,支持面向对象也支持面向过程,功能强大所支持的第三方库众多;缺点:运行速度慢(解释型语言的通病),代码的加密困难(直接运行源代码)注意点:严格区分大小写,代码行首字符不能为数字,严格要求缩进python&pycharm的安装配置思考?1:在python命令行中有几种退出方式?
quit(
转载
2023-12-20 10:19:43
38阅读
NI Linux是一种基于Linux操作系统的嵌入式系统,它为用户提供了强大而灵活的开发环境,能够帮助用户快速搭建自己的嵌入式系统。红帽作为一家知名的Linux发行版提供商,对NI Linux的发展和推广起到了重要的作用。
红帽公司成立于1993年,是一家专注于开源软件的公司,其旗下的红帽Linux成为了业界最受欢迎的Linux发行版之一。随着嵌入式系统在各个行业的应用逐渐普及,NI Linu
原创
2024-03-04 12:50:09
87阅读
NI公司有很多款性能比较好的数据采集卡,我实验室有数据采集卡6353和USB-6210,都是USB连接电脑,只是供电方式不同,通道数目不同,我都编过一些程序,程序编写是一样的,都是调用NI公司提供的DAQmx里面的函数,让数据采集卡按照我们的要求工作,这里我只介绍USB-6210吧。
刚开始学数据采集卡时,关于数据采集卡的C语言程序时不好找,大多数是通过NI公司的labview控制的,用C
转载
2021-02-04 16:33:00
707阅读
2评论
需要pycharm激活的朋友可以看一下这里,当然只是应急一下,还是要自己购买正版软件的。文件操作 内置函数 open:def open(file, mode='r', buffering=None, encoding=None, errors=None, newline=None, closefd=True):注意open之后一定要close,释放流资源!mode :方式rb read binar
转载
2024-05-30 09:56:34
30阅读